> >> BUN 1: prop_coeff, int_coeff, tdctargetcnt programming updated and tied to
> >> VCO frequencies. Program i_lockthresh in PORT_PLL_9.
> >>
> >> VCO calculated based on the formula:
> >> Desired Output = Port bit rate in MHz (DisplayPort HBR2 is 5400 MHz)
> >> Fast Clock = Desired Output / 2
> >> VCO = Fast Clock * P1 * P2
> >>
> >> Prop_coeff, int_coeff, and tdctargetcnt modified according to above
> >> calculation.
> >>
> >> BUN 2: Port PLLs require additional programming at certain frequencies -
> >> DCO amplitude in PORT_PLL_10
> >>
> >> Review comments from Siva which were addressed in the initial version of the
> >> patch.
> >> - Change PORT_PLL_LOCK_THRESHOLD to PORT_PLL_LOCK_THRESHOLD_MASK
> >> - Calculate for HDMI
> >> - Correct values for vco = 5.4
> >> - return in case of invalid vco range
> >>
